Outline of Final Research Achievements |
For the oscillation of gyro-devices, the effect of position and velocity spreads of the electrons injecting into the resonator was theoretically and experimentally investigated. Reduction of the electron velocity spread was realized by a new electron gun designed optimally to the gyro-device. Axis deviation of the gyro-device against the magnetic coil axis leads to increase the position spread of the electrons. Improvement of the electron gun and fine tuning of the installation position of the gyro-device increase the oscillation efficiency in expriments. This result was consistent with the theoretical calculation. It was found the effect of the position spread is larger on the oscillation efficiency for a well-designed gyro-device.
